No verdict in careless driving trial

The jury in the trial of a motorist accused of careless driving causing the death of an elderly Kilkenny man near Mitchelstown two years ago failed to reach a verdict yesterday after four hours of deliberation.

Judge Seán Ó Donnabháin asked the jury at lunchtime yesterday if additional time for deliberation would be of any use for them. The jury foreperson replied that further time would not help.

Acknowledging this deadlock the judge instructed them to write “disagree” on the issue paper. The judge added: “Don’t worry about it, you did your best.”
